Hi all, I noticed that loading linux from loadlin (2.1.97, others untested) with 128 megs of ram leads to a 64M only detection by the kernel. With lilo, everything works fine. Windows (osr2) detects the entire memory. I'm not sure this is purely kernel-related, but anyway ... :)
